poster

Baghdad Express (2008)

NR | Oct 27, 2008 (US) | | 00:11

A young girl working in her father's Arabic restaurant is forced to decide which comes first - her dreams or her family.

Featured Crew

Director, Writer
Original Music Composer
Director of Photography

Images